What Size Dumpster Do You Need?

There is no one-size-fits-all answer to the question of how to rent a dumpster. The sort of garbage, the amount of trash, the rental weight of the junk, and your budget all play a role in figuring out what size container you need for a specific waste removal project. The following information about dumpster size might help you make a smart choice about whether or not to rent one.

The Most Common Dumpster Size

Before choosing a size, you should know what your options are. Dumpsters for rent range in length from 10 to 40 yards. The standard unit of measurement is the cubic yard, which is used to describe how much they can hold. Dumpsters with 20 cubic yards

Our 20-yard dumpster is among the most popular size we offer for rent. This is due to the fact that they can carry a lot of trash and are cheaper than larger dumpsters. It is estimated that a 20-yard dumpster can store the equivalent of six truckloads of trash or waste. These are some of the most common applications of our 20-yard dumpster:

Dumpsters with 40 cubic yards

Construction and demolition projects that result in a large amount of waste are good candidates for a 40-yard container. This is roughly equivalent to 12 pickup truck loads with trash and garbage.

If you choose a dumpster that is too small, you may end up having to pay more for it over time.

There is no way that 15 yards of trash can fit into a 10-yard container. If you have to pick up and drop off before the project is done, the total cost will go up. Since the rental fee is based on one load, the company that provides the roll-off dumpster will have to pay twice as much to pick up the trash. Don’t ask for a discount because they have to pay a driver again for the time it takes to deliver and pick up the dumpster. At first, it will cost less to order a 20-yard container.

Don’t put too much in the junk can

You might be tempted to try to get around a dumpster that is too small if you pile trash up to the top of the rim. Don’t do it! The dumpster company is not allowed by law to take the container away if there is trash on top of it, which is dangerous. Most vehicles will leave a job site before the debris is cleared, and the container won’t be picked up until then. Some trash collectors can jump up and throw trash into the dumpster to level it. Adding an “overloading service charge” and getting rid of the extra stuff will cost more money.
